SpyLocked 4.2 Threat Level: SpyLocked 4.2 is a pest

SpyLocked 4.2 screenshotSpyLocked 4.2 is the latest version of everyone’s favorite rogue — or fake — anti-spyware software. Like other versions of SpyLocked, SpyLocked 4.2 may install onto your PC through web browser security holes in your computer accessed by a Trojan. And also similar to other versions of SpyLocked, SpyLocked 4.2 may try and scare you into you buying the “full version” of its software by popping up fake or exagerrated security alerts that your system is infected with spyware and malware. SpyLocked 4.2’s security warning may read:

“System has detected a number of active spyware applications that may impact the performance of your computer. Click the icon to get rid of unwanted spyware by downloading an up-to-date anti-spyware solution.”

When creating these false warnings, SpyLocked 4.2 may note clean software and files on your PC as dangerous, to try and scare you. When you’re infected with SpyLocked 4.2, you may also experience tons of ads. Unless you enjoy popup ads, we recommend you remove SpyLocked 4.2 immediately.

SpyLocked 4.2 may be compared to SpywareQuake, SpySheriff, Pest Trap, and SpyHeal, and ContraVirus. SpyLocked 4.2 may recreate itself, making it extremely difficult to manually delete. www.SpyLocked.com may be SpyLocked 4.2’s official site.
